APP开发完整流程全景图包含市场调研原型制作UIUX设计前后端开发真机调试与多平台发布关键环节 (app开发需要多长时间)

资讯 7

APP开发并非一蹴而就的技术堆砌,而是一个环环相扣、高度协同的系统工程。从最初一个模糊的创意火花,到最终用户指尖轻点即可下载使用的成熟产品,其背后涵盖市场调研、原型制作、UI/UX设计、前后端开发、真机调试及多平台发布六大关键环节,每个阶段既承担不可替代的功能价值,又彼此深度咬合、动态反馈。这一全景流程不仅决定了产品的市场适配性与用户体验质量,更直接塑造了项目周期的弹性边界——所谓“APP开发需要多长时间”,本质上不是由代码行数或功能点数量单向决定的,而是由各环节的严谨性、团队协作效率、需求变更频次以及目标平台复杂度共同构成的动态函数。

市场调研是整条开发链路的逻辑起点与价值校准器。它远不止于竞品罗列或用户画像描摹,而是通过定量问卷、深度访谈、行为数据抓取与行业趋势研判,精准识别真实痛点、验证商业模式可行性,并界定核心用户群的使用场景与决策路径。若此阶段流于表面,后续所有投入都可能陷入“伪需求陷阱”:功能越完善,离用户越远。典型案例如某本地生活类APP在未充分调研社区中老年群体数字鸿沟现状下强行推进复杂预约流程,上线后激活率不足12%,被迫返工重构交互逻辑,无形中拉长整体周期近40%。

原型制作则是将抽象洞察转化为可触摸、可验证的结构化表达。低保真线框图聚焦信息架构与任务流合理性,高保真交互原型则模拟真实操作反馈与状态跳转。此阶段强调“快速试错”:通过A/B测试不同导航路径、按钮位置或表单字段顺序,用数据而非主观判断确认最优方案。值得注意的是,原型并非设计终稿,而是开发团队与产品经理、运营方达成共识的“契约文本”。当原型未明确标注异常状态处理逻辑(如网络中断时的加载提示样式、支付失败后的跳转路径),后续开发中必然爆发大量沟通成本与返工风险。

UI/UX设计在此基础上注入情感温度与认知效率。UI设计解决“如何美而一致”,需建立完整的设计系统(Design System):包含色彩语义规范(如红色仅用于错误警示)、字体层级规则、图标语义库及动效节奏标准,确保跨页面视觉语言统一;UX设计则深耕“如何自然而高效”,通过用户旅程地图识别关键摩擦点,例如将注册流程从5步压缩至3步并支持微信一键授权,可使转化率提升27%。设计交付物必须包含标注文件(含间距、字号、交互反馈说明)与切图资源包,否则前端还原偏差将成常态。

前后端开发构成技术实现双引擎。前端开发需兼顾多端适配:iOS遵循Human Interface Guidelines,Android遵循Material Design 3,而小程序则受限于平台运行环境与API权限。现代框架如React Native或Flutter虽提升跨端效率,但对原生性能敏感模块(如实时音视频、AR渲染)仍需混合开发。后端开发则需构建弹性可扩展的微服务架构,重点保障接口稳定性(99.99%可用性)、数据安全(符合等保2.0三级要求)及灰度发布能力。数据库选型须匹配业务特征——高频读写订单场景宜用分库分表+Redis缓存,而内容聚合类应用则倾向文档型数据库提升查询灵活性。

真机调试是脱离模拟器幻觉的关键跃迁。模拟器无法复现真实网络抖动、后台进程杀戮、传感器精度差异及系统级省电策略干扰。专业团队需在覆盖主流品牌、OS版本、屏幕分辨率的百台真机矩阵上执行兼容性测试,尤其关注国产安卓厂商深度定制系统(如华为EMUI、小米MIUI)的权限管理机制与通知栏策略变化。自动化测试脚本可覆盖80%基础用例,但核心路径(如支付闭环、消息推送到达率)必须人工遍历,因为算法难以识别“按钮点击无响应”与“视觉反馈延迟200ms导致操作挫败感”的体验本质差异。

多平台发布绝非简单打包上传。App Store审核需严守《App Store审核指南》第4.3条关于界面原创性与功能完整性的规定,Google Play则重点关注隐私政策披露与数据最小化原则。国内各大应用商店更要求ICP备案号、软著证书及内容安全承诺书。发布后首周需密集监控崩溃率(Crash Rate<0.5%为健康阈值)、ANR率及热更新成功率,任何指标异动均需启动分钟级响应机制。真正成熟的发布流程应包含灰度发布(先开放1%用户)、AB测试分流、实时日志采集与自动回滚预案,将上线风险控制在可控维度。

综上,一个中等复杂度APP(含用户体系、LBS服务、支付模块、后台CMS)在需求稳定、团队配置合理(5人全栈团队)、无重大技术债务前提下,标准周期约为14–18周。但若市场调研压缩至3天、原型未经用户验证即进入开发、设计系统缺失导致前端反复调整,则周期极易突破26周。时间从来不是被“花费”的,而是在每个环节的专业深度与敬畏心之中被精准“锻造”出来的。